• Irish_Wine Likes this wine: 95 points

    November 26, 2023 - Expressive dried and fresh apricot on the nose. Layers of orange peel, honeycomb and toasted hazelnut. Lovely touches of white blossoms. Full bodied with precise interplay between sweetness and freshness. A burst of saffron. Huge persistence on the finish. Delicious. Drink now or hold.

    WSET Notes:

    Pale amber.

    Pronounced on the nose with apricot, orange zest, white blossom, honeycomb, dried apricot, toast, biscuit and hazelnut. Developing.

    Pronounced and sweet on the palate with saffron coming through. Full body, high alcohol, high acidity, long finish.

    Can drink now but has potential for ageing.

  • csimm wrote: 95 points

    July 27, 2023 - This bottle of 2008 Yquem (.750ml) is in the most beautiful place in its evolution at the moment. Hallmark Yquem, the balance and flavor expansion are utterly harmonious, with the distribution of weight, sweetness, and acidity all on perfect point. The savory elements are so nuanced that the execution carries an airiness that floats the lemon, honeydew, dried apricot, fresh white flowers, fresh herbs, and white rock elements across the palate in an effortless cadence. Finishes as it starts, on a textural glide that coats the mouth with a thin layer of viscosity, gently dissipating on the tail. Impresses most for its equilibrium and subsequent food pairing versatility, which of course was pretty amazing with a seared foie gras and stone fruit tart dish with spiced mascarpone and candied pecans. More please.
